> You wrote "lintian also detects a spelling-error-in-manpage ->
> patch" but in my case lintian doesn't talk about it. My lintian
> version is 2.5.1 and I don't use options.

That's the problem :)
Please enable the info and pedantic options.

What I'm using is:
lintian -i -I --show-overrides --pedantic --color auto foo.changes

Or, actually I've started to use ~/.lintianrc:

$ cat ~/.lintianrc
display-info=yes
info=yes
pedantic=yes
show-overrides=yes
color=auto
#display-experimental=yes
